Adverbs which modify adjectives, prepositions, noun phrases, and other adverbs appear immediately in front of those items:

  • Je ne suis pas vraiment mauvais (modifying an adjective)

I'm not really bad

  • Nous irons loin au-delà de la frontière (modifying a preposition)

We'll go far beyond the frontier

  • Il y a au moins dix ans (modifying a noun phrase)

At least ten years ago

  • Je suis ici depuis très longtemps (modifying an adverb)

I have been here for a very long time
